Hackensack, New Jersey Climate Summary General Climate • Humid subtropical climate (Köppen Cfa) • Characterized by hot, humid summers and mild winters Temperature • Average Annual Temperature 54.9°F (12.7°C) • Average Summer Temperature (June-August) 75.6°F (24.2°C) • Average Winter Temperature (December-February) 33.5°F (0.8°C) • Record High Temperature 106°F (41°C) • Record Low Temperature -13°F (-25°C) Precipitation • Average Annual Precipitation 45.43 inches (115.4 cm) • Average Monthly Precipitation 3.79 inches (9.6 cm) • Wettest Month July (4.72 inches / 12 cm) • Driest Month February (2.69 inches / 6.8 cm) • Average Annual Snowfall 22.7 inches (57.7 cm) Humidity • Average Annual Relative Humidity 70% • High Humidity Months June-August (75-80%) • Low Humidity Months January-March (65-70%) Wind • Average Annual Wind Speed 10.2 mph (16.4 km/h) • Prevailing Wind Direction West-southwest Sunshine • Average Annual Sunshine 2,600 hours • Sunniest Month July (300 hours) • Cloudiest Month December (180 hours) Other Climate Features • Tornado Risk Low • Hurricane Risk Moderate • Extreme Heat Days (90°F+) 15-20 per year • Extreme Cold Days (32°F-) 30-40 per year Climate Trends • Rising Temperatures Over the past century, average temperatures in Hackensack have increased by about 2°F (1.1°C). • Increasing Precipitation Annual precipitation has also increased slightly, with more intense rainfall events occurring. • More Extreme Weather The frequency and intensity of extreme weather events, such as heat waves, droughts, and floods, is expected to increase in the future. |
